Objet objet intégré

objectTextDecoder

Objet de décodage TextDecoder

Méthode de création

1
var textDecoder = new util.TextDecoder('utf8');

relation d'héritage

Constructeur

TextDecoder

Constructeur d'objet TextDecoder, construit avec des paramètres

1 2
new TextDecoder(String codec = "utf8", Object opts = {});

Paramètres d'appel :

  • codec: Chaîne, spécifie le jeu de caractères de décodage
  • opts: Objet, spécifie les options de décodage

attribut de membre

encoding

Chaîne, interroge le jeu de caractères codés actuel

1
readonly String TextDecoder.encoding;

fonction membre

decode

Convertir des données binaires en texte

1 2
String TextDecoder.decode(Buffer data, Object opts = {});

Paramètres d'appel :

  • data:Buffer, le binaire à convertir
  • opts: Objet, spécifie les options de décodage

résultat de retour :

  • String, renvoie le texte décodé

Convertir des données binaires en texte

1
String TextDecoder.decode();

résultat de retour :

  • String, renvoie le texte décodé

toString

Renvoie la représentation sous forme de chaîne de l'objet, renvoie généralement "[Native Object]", l'objet peut être réimplémenté selon ses propres caractéristiques

1
String TextDecoder.toString();

résultat de retour :

  • String, renvoie une représentation sous forme de chaîne de l'objet

toJSON

Renvoie la représentation au format JSON de l'objet, renvoie généralement une collection de propriétés lisibles définies par l'objet

1
Value TextDecoder.toJSON(String key = "");

Paramètres d'appel :

  • key: Chaîne, non utilisée

résultat de retour :

  • Value, qui renvoie une valeur sérialisable JSON